Meaning, pronunciation, translations and examples WebHelsinki's 2024 population is now estimated at 1,337,786. In 1950, the population of Helsinki was 365,629. Helsinki has grown by 10,024 in the last year, which represents a 0.75% annual change. These population estimates and projections come from the latest revision of the UN World Urbanization Prospects.These estimates represent the Urban …

Each capital is quite different and has much to offer. … how do i empty trash on my kindleWebHelsinki (Swedish: Helsingfors) is the capital city of Finland metropolitan area. Helsinki is in the south of Finland, on the coast of the Gulf of Finland.The city is in the Uusimaa region. When one looks from Helsinki, Tallinn is on the opposite side of the sea, but it is too far away to see.
